The Product, Model, Plan, or Service Most Relevant to Cellular Home Monitoring

The MobileHelp Classic Cellular is the product most relevant to this use case. It is an in-home medical alert system that connects to AT&T's cellular network and requires no landline or separate cellular plan [4]. The system includes a base station that plugs into a power outlet, plus waterproof wearable help buttons (pendant and wrist) that communicate with the base station [7]. MobileHelp positions Classic as a home-only system and identifies its Elite product as the option for on-the-go coverage [9].

Use-Case-Specific Features and Capabilities

Cellular network coverage. Classic Cellular uses AT&T's nationwide 4G LTE network [52]. MobileHelp does not provide a property-specific coverage guarantee in its cited materials [54]. The company recommends confirming AT&T coverage at the specific address before purchase [55]. Service availability is not guaranteed everywhere and at all times [56].

Setup simplicity. The system is designed for self-installation: plug in the base station, wait for steady connection indicators, and test the help button [54]. No phone outlet, landline, technician, or programming is required [57].

Base station signal reliability and range. MobileHelp advertises up to 1,400 feet of in-home coverage [54]. Independent testing in a two-story office environment verified approximately 200 feet of reliable range, with walls and obstacles reducing performance [61]. Effective range can be lower in multi-story buildings, large residences, or structures with signal-obstructing materials [54].

Backup battery duration. The base station continues operating for approximately 30 hours during a power outage [54]. Independent testing confirmed approximately 28 hours [63]. Wearable button batteries last over 5 years without charging [62]. The base station should remain plugged into power during normal operation [54].

Fall detection support. An optional Fall Button is available for $10–$11 per month and is compatible with Classic [64]. Independent testing found it detected 8 out of 10 simulated falls, on par with competing systems [66]. MobileHelp expressly states fall detection does not detect 100% of falls and users should press the help button when able [64]. The Fall Button works approximately 600 feet from the cellular base station [66].

Waterproof wearable design. Two waterproof help buttons (pendant and wrist) are included at no extra cost [67]. They are lightweight, comfortable for continuous wear, and safe for shower use [68].

Emergency response performance. MobileHelp operates a 24/7 U.S.-based emergency monitoring center [70]. Independent testing reported average response times of 18–26 seconds, within the industry average of 15–45 seconds [71]. Fall detection response time averaged 48 seconds in one test [73].

Pricing, Fees, Contracts, and Ongoing Costs

Pricing confidence is low due to conflicting public information. The official Classic Cellular product page currently displays $25.95/month as the starting subscription price [74]. Other MobileHelp pages and independent reviews cite $24.95/month [75]. DeepSeek reported $19.95/month with a 3-year contract [77]. Kimi reported it could not verify current pricing [78].

Known costs from cited sources:

Cost itemAmountSource
Monthly monitoring (Classic Cellular)$24.95–$25.95[74], [75]
Quarterly billing$77.85 (3 months)[79]
Annual billing$285.45 (12 months)[79]
Fall detection add-on$10–$11/month[80], [81]
Wall mount button$2.95/month[82]
OnGuard text alerts$2.99/month[82]
Connect Premium plan$6/month[82]
Activation fee$49.95 (reported by DeepSeek only)[77]
Shipping fee$19.95 non-refundable (reported by DeepSeek only)[77]

Contract and cancellation terms conflict. MobileHelp's FAQ says no contract, month-to-month, cancellable at any time [83]. MobileHelp's Terms and Conditions state a three-month minimum commitment [85]. DeepSeek reported 1–3 year contracts with early cancellation penalties up to $100 [77]. Grok reported month-to-month with no cancellation fees [87].

Additional fees on cancellation. The posted terms mention a $50 restocking fee for certain returns [85]. The return policy requires equipment returns in some circumstances and makes the customer responsible for return shipping [88]. A $350 equipment charge applies if equipment is not returned within 30 days after service termination [85]. Prorated refunds are available for unused service on prepaid plans [86].

Equipment is leased, not owned. Customers receive equipment at no upfront cost while actively subscribed, but must return it upon cancellation or pay the $350 equipment fee [89].

Best Suited For

MobileHelp Classic Cellular is best suited for seniors and caregivers who:

  • Live in apartments, condos, or typical homes where the user primarily needs protection inside the residence [91]
  • Want plug-in installation rather than a landline connection or separate cellular plan [92]
  • Are cost-conscious and want optional fall detection with a long base-station range [92]
  • Have confirmed strong AT&T cellular coverage at their specific address [95]
  • Prefer a traditional medical alert brand with 24/7 U.S.-based monitoring [96]
  • Are comfortable with a leasing model rather than equipment ownership [97]
  • Want waterproof help buttons safe for shower use [98]

Probably Not Best Suited For

MobileHelp Classic Cellular is probably not best suited for:

  • Users who need reliable protection outside the home; MobileHelp Elite or another mobile GPS system is more appropriate [99]
  • Homes or buildings with weak or inconsistent AT&T cellular coverage [100]
  • Buyers who require highly transparent, consistently published pricing or a verified month-to-month cancellation policy before ordering [102]
  • Very large homes requiring coverage beyond 1,400 feet from the base station [104]
  • Buyers needing the fastest possible emergency response times under 15 seconds consistently [105]
  • Users requiring advanced caregiver coordination apps; independent testing reported the caregiver app as glitchy and difficult to use [106]
  • Those preferring equipment ownership over a leasing model [107]
  • Users who want a discreet smartwatch form factor rather than a traditional pendant or wrist button [101]

When Another Option May Be Better

Consider another option when:

  • AT&T coverage is poor at the residence. MobileHelp relies exclusively on AT&T's network [108]. Providers using Verizon or T-Mobile networks, such as Lively or Medical Guardian with Verizon options, may be better in areas where AT&T is weak [110].
  • Fastest response times are critical. Bay Alarm Medical and Medical Guardian averaged faster response times than MobileHelp in independent testing [111].
  • Fall detection must be included in the base plan. Some competitors include fall detection standard, while MobileHelp charges $10–$11/month extra [112].
  • Equipment ownership is preferred. MobileHelp leases equipment and requires return or a $350 charge on cancellation [113]. Some competitors allow equipment purchase.
  • Advanced caregiver coordination is needed. Competitors offer more robust caregiver features and apps [114].
  • Very large homes need greater range. Some competing systems offer more than 1,400 feet of coverage [115].
  • Lowest cost is the priority. Hygge offers cellular monitoring at $14.99/month or $79.99/year, though for environmental monitoring rather than medical alert response [116].
  • Smart home integration or video calling is required. Livindi offers WiFi/LTE bundles with video calling at $45/month [117], and SimpliSafe or Vivint offer smart home integration [118].

Questions to Verify Before Buying

  1. What exact AT&T network technology and coverage level will serve the buyer's address, including the specific apartment or condo unit? [119]
  2. What is the exact monthly, quarterly, semiannual, or annual price on the order being placed, and when does any promotional price expire? [121]
  3. Is there a three-month minimum commitment despite the FAQ's month-to-month language? [123]
  4. If service is canceled, is equipment return required, who pays shipping, and does a $50 restocking fee apply? [123]
  5. What charge applies if equipment is not returned, and when does that charge become payable? [123]
  6. How is the approximately 30-hour battery figure measured, and does it vary with cellular conditions or call volume? [119]
  7. What exact Fall Button model is supplied, what is its battery type and replacement process, and is the $10–$11 monthly fee recurring for the full subscription? [127]
  8. Can the buyer test the system from every room, balcony, garage, basement, and common area that matters before the return period ends? [129]
  9. Does the monitoring center have the buyer's current address, emergency contacts, access instructions, and preferred response protocol? [130]
  10. Are activation, shipping, accessories, lockbox, premium support, or replacement-device fees included or charged separately? [131]
